Subject: [PULL 02/30] qapi: Tidy up whitespace in generated code
Date: Wed, 14 Dec 2022 08:46:53 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20221214074721.731441-5-armbru@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20221214074721.731441-1-armbru@redhat.com>

Signed-off-by: Markus Armbruster <armbru@redhat.com>
Reviewed-by: Daniel P. Berrangé <berrange@redhat.com>
Message-Id: <20221104160712.3005652-3-armbru@redhat.com>
---
 docs/devel/qapi-code-gen.rst | 1 -
 scripts/qapi/commands.py     | 7 +++----
 scripts/qapi/events.py       | 1 -
 3 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)

diff --git a/docs/devel/qapi-code-gen.rst b/docs/devel/qapi-code-gen.rst
index 997313fce7..b56ea4546d 100644
--- a/docs/devel/qapi-code-gen.rst
+++ b/docs/devel/qapi-code-gen.rst
@@ -1664,7 +1664,6 @@ Example::
     $ cat qapi-generated/example-qapi-commands.c
     [Uninteresting stuff omitted...]
 
-
     static void qmp_marshal_output_UserDefOne(UserDefOne *ret_in,
                                     QObject **ret_out, Error **errp)
     {
diff --git a/scripts/qapi/commands.py b/scripts/qapi/commands.py
index 38ca38a7b9..cf68aaf0bf 100644
--- a/scripts/qapi/commands.py
+++ b/scripts/qapi/commands.py
@@ -83,7 +83,7 @@ def gen_call(name: str,
 
         trace_qmp_enter_%(name)s(req_json->str);
     }
-    ''',
+''',
                      upper=upper, name=name)
 
     ret += mcgen('''
@@ -124,13 +124,13 @@ def gen_call(name: str,
 
         trace_qmp_exit_%(name)s(ret_json->str, true);
     }
-    ''',
+''',
                          upper=upper, name=name)
         else:
             ret += mcgen('''
 
     trace_qmp_exit_%(name)s("{}", true);
-    ''',
+''',
                          name=name)
 
     return ret
@@ -316,7 +316,6 @@ def _begin_user_module(self, name: str) -> None:
 #include "qapi/error.h"
 #include "%(visit)s.h"
 #include "%(commands)s.h"
-
 ''',
                              commands=commands, visit=visit))
 
diff --git a/scripts/qapi/events.py b/scripts/qapi/events.py
index 27b44c49f5..e762d53d19 100644
--- a/scripts/qapi/events.py
+++ b/scripts/qapi/events.py
@@ -196,7 +196,6 @@ def _begin_user_module(self, name: str) -> None:
 #include "qapi/error.h"
 #include "qapi/qmp/qdict.h"
 #include "qapi/qmp-event.h"
-
 ''',
                              events=events, visit=visit,
                              prefix=self._prefix))
